Which culture/time period made waddle and daub homes?​
Nastasia [14]

Answer:

hope this helps

Explanation:

Neolithic

The wattle and daub technique was used already in the Neolithic period. It was common for houses of Linear pottery and Rössen cultures of Central Europe, but is also found in Western Asia (Çatalhöyük, Shillourokambos) as well as in North America (Mississippian culture) and South America (Brazil).
